How Enterprises Can Measure the Real Value of Generative AI

 Generative artificial intelligence is quickly becoming part of everyday business operations. Companies are using it to answer customer questions, review documents, support employees, improve workflows, and create new digital experiences.

But once the initial excitement fades, business leaders face an important question:

Is the investment actually creating enough value?

The answer cannot come from software costs alone. A realistic business case needs to consider productivity, revenue, security, data, governance, implementation, maintenance, and the potential cost of mistakes.

Start With a Real Business Problem

The strongest projects don't begin with a technology demo. They begin with a problem that needs to be solved.

A business might want to:

  • Process documents faster
  • Reduce repetitive customer support work
  • Improve response times
  • Reduce manual data entry
  • Increase sales conversion
  • Help employees find information faster
  • Improve customer experiences

Once the problem is clear, define how success will be measured.

For example, a company could set a target of reducing document processing time by 40% or cutting repetitive support work by 30%.

Having a baseline makes the results much easier to evaluate.

Look at the Complete Cost

A common mistake is to calculate only the cost of the software or platform.

The actual investment can include:

  • Computing and infrastructure
  • Software and usage fees
  • Data preparation
  • System integration
  • Security
  • Monitoring
  • Development and maintenance
  • Employee training
  • Governance

A small pilot may appear inexpensive, but costs can change considerably when the solution moves into production.

Calculating the total cost from the beginning gives decision-makers a clearer picture.

Time Savings Are Only Part of the Story

Imagine a company saves 400 employee hours every month.

That sounds like a direct financial saving, but the real value depends on what employees do with that time.

If employees use those hours to serve more customers, process more applications, improve sales activities, or handle complex tasks, the business may create significantly more value.

The important question isn't simply:

How much time did we save?

It is:

What valuable work can now be done with that time?

Revenue Can Be Part of the Return

Business value isn't limited to reducing costs.

A well-designed solution can also contribute to revenue growth.

Companies can measure:

  • Conversion rates
  • Customer retention
  • Number of customers served
  • Sales cycle duration
  • Customer satisfaction
  • New service opportunities
  • Employee capacity

For example, a customer support solution may not reduce the number of employees.

Instead, it may allow the same team to handle a larger volume of customers without increasing staffing costs.

That additional capacity has measurable value.

Security and Risk Belong in the Calculation

Every technology investment comes with some level of risk.

With generative artificial intelligence, companies should consider questions such as:

  • Could confidential information be exposed?
  • What happens when an incorrect response reaches a customer?
  • How reliable is the underlying data?
  • Could the system create compliance problems?
  • How quickly can an incident be detected?

Security controls, access management, data protection, monitoring, and incident response therefore need to be considered as part of the business case.

They aren't simply additional expenses. They help protect the value created by the investment.

A Practical Return Framework

A simple framework can help organizations evaluate projects consistently.

1. Total Cost

Calculate the complete cost of building, operating, securing, and maintaining the solution.

2. Operational Savings

Measure reductions in manual work, processing time, errors, and operating expenses.

3. Revenue and Business Value

Measure improvements in conversion, customer experience, capacity, productivity, or new services.

4. Risk Adjustment

Consider how security incidents, poor data quality, incorrect results, or compliance issues could reduce the expected return.

This approach gives leadership a more balanced view than focusing on productivity numbers alone.

Measure During the Pilot

A pilot should not only answer:

Does the technology work?

It should also answer:

Does the technology create enough value to justify scaling?

Before starting the pilot, establish a baseline.

For example:

Before:
1,000 hours per month are spent processing documents.

After:
600 hours are required.

The difference provides a measurable starting point.

The business can then compare the value of those savings with technology, security, governance, and operational costs.

Governance Can Improve Long-Term Value

Governance is sometimes viewed as something that slows down innovation.

In reality, effective governance can make scaling easier.

Clear processes for data access, model evaluation, security, monitoring, and accountability reduce uncertainty and help teams respond to problems quickly.

Once those processes are established, future projects can use the same foundation.

Instead of treating every project as a separate experiment, the organization starts building a repeatable capability.

From Pilot to Enterprise Scale

A practical process looks like this:

Identify the problem → Establish a baseline → Run a controlled pilot → Measure results → Strengthen security and governance → Calculate business value → Decide whether to scale

This approach also creates a common language across departments.

Technology teams can focus on performance and reliability.

Security teams can focus on protection.

Finance teams can evaluate cost and return.

Business leaders can focus on measurable outcomes.

Everyone is working from the same evidence.

A Simple Enterprise Example

Consider a mid-sized mortgage company using generative artificial intelligence to assist with customer inquiries and document processing.

Before implementation, employees spend significant time handling repetitive requests and reviewing documents manually.

The company establishes a baseline and launches a controlled pilot.

After implementation, it measures:

  • Faster document processing
  • Lower handling time
  • Fewer errors
  • Improved customer conversion
  • Reduced operational effort

The company then compares these benefits with the cost of infrastructure, security, governance, monitoring, and maintenance.

This creates a much stronger business case than simply saying the new system is "saving time."

Don't Wait Until Deployment to Think About Return

Waiting until the end of a project to calculate return can create unnecessary problems.

A company might discover that:

  • Employees aren't using the solution
  • Operating costs are higher than expected
  • Data quality limits performance
  • Security requirements increase costs
  • The expected business benefit isn't large enough
  • The use case isn't suitable for large-scale deployment

These issues are easier to address during a pilot.

Return should therefore be measured continuously rather than treated as a final report.
